Medea Hotel Moscow Medea Hotel MoscowMedea Hotel Moscow is easily accessible, as the railway station is 2 kilometres away and the city centre is 0.8 kilometres away. The tourist attractions include the Kremlin, Red Square and Vasily, the Blessed Cathedral. The hotel boasts 21 air-conditioned bedrooms that are comfortable and well equipped. Attentive room service is also available for your convenience.
Guests can dine at the on site restaurant and later unwind with a refreshing drink at the bar. Business travellers can make use of the business centre, available at the premises. For your relaxation, the Medea Hotel provides sauna and a gymnasium.
